    How AI Undress Works

    AI Undress technology relies on deep learning algorithms, particularly convolutional neural networks (CNNs), to analyze and manipulate images. These algorithms are trained on vast datasets of images to identify patterns and features associated with clothing and human anatomy. Once trained, the AI can digitally "remove" clothing from an image, creating the illusion of nudity.

    The process begins with image segmentation, where the AI identifies different parts of the image, such as clothing, skin, and background. Next, the AI uses generative adversarial networks (GANs) to reconstruct the image without the clothing, filling in the gaps with realistic skin textures and anatomical details. This combination of segmentation and generation allows the AI to produce highly convincing results.

    Key Technologies Behind AI Undress

    • Convolutional Neural Networks (CNNs): Used for image recognition and feature extraction.
    • Generative Adversarial Networks (GANs): Generate realistic images by pitting two neural networks against each other.
    • Image Segmentation: Identifies and isolates specific parts of an image for manipulation.

    Risks and Misuse of AI Undress

    One of the most significant risks of AI Undress technology is its potential for misuse in creating non-consensual explicit content, commonly referred to as "deepfake pornography." This misuse violates individuals' privacy and can lead to severe emotional and psychological harm. Victims of such content often face public shaming, harassment, and damage to their reputations.

    AI Undress tools are also accessible to anyone with an internet connection, making it easier for malicious actors to exploit them. Social media platforms and online forums have reported cases of users sharing AI-generated explicit images without consent, further amplifying the harm caused by this technology. The ease of access and anonymity provided by the internet exacerbates the problem, making it difficult to hold perpetrators accountable.

    Examples of AI Undress Misuse

    • Non-consensual explicit content targeting celebrities and public figures.
    • Cyberbullying and harassment using AI-generated images.
    • Revenge porn involving AI-manipulated photos.

    The legal landscape surrounding AI Undress is still evolving, with many jurisdictions struggling to keep pace with the rapid advancement of this technology. In some countries, laws have been enacted to address the creation and distribution of non-consensual explicit content. For example, the United States has laws against revenge porn, which can be applied to AI-generated images in certain cases.

    However, enforcement remains a challenge due to the global nature of the internet and the anonymity provided by online platforms. Legal experts argue that new regulations are needed to specifically address the misuse of AI Undress technology. These regulations should focus on holding creators and distributors of non-consensual content accountable while also protecting freedom of expression.

    Ethical Concerns Surrounding AI Undress

    The ethical implications of AI Undress are profound, as the technology raises questions about consent, privacy, and the responsible use of AI. One of the primary concerns is the lack of informed consent from individuals whose images are manipulated. Unlike traditional photography or videography, AI Undress operates without the subject's knowledge or permission, violating their autonomy and dignity.

    Another ethical issue is the normalization of non-consensual explicit content. As AI Undress tools become more widespread, there is a risk that society may become desensitized to the harm caused by such content. This normalization could lead to a culture of exploitation and objectification, further eroding respect for individual privacy and consent.

    Preventing Misuse of AI Undress

    Preventing the misuse of AI Undress requires a multi-faceted approach involving technology, policy, and education. One effective strategy is the development of AI-powered tools to detect and block non-consensual explicit content. These tools can be integrated into social media platforms and content-sharing websites to identify and remove harmful images before they are widely distributed.

    Education and awareness campaigns are also crucial in combating the misuse of AI Undress. By educating the public about the risks and ethical implications of this technology, we can foster a culture of respect and consent. Schools, community organizations, and online platforms can play a vital role in spreading awareness and promoting responsible behavior.

    Technological Solutions

    • AI-based content detection systems.
    • Watermarking and digital signatures to verify image authenticity.
    • Blockchain technology for tracking image ownership and usage.
